Unrepairable substrates of nucleotide excision repair and their application to suppress the activity of this repair system
In the previous studies, the DNA with the bulky Fap-dC derivative was demonstrated to be a difficult substrate for the nucleotide excision repair (NER), a system which is involved in the removal of bulky lesions from DNA.
